- Importance of utilizing essential technologies for remote success

Utilizing essential technologies is crucial for remote work success, especially when it comes to communication and collaboration. Communication and collaboration tools like Slack, Microsoft Teams, and Zoom provide a seamless avenue for employees to connect and interact with each other, regardless of their physical location. These tools not only enable real-time conversations and discussions but also facilitate file sharing and document collaboration, ensuring that work progresses smoothly.

When working remotely, it is essential to have a reliable platform for team communication. Slack, for example, allows employees to create channels dedicated to specific projects or topics, fostering efficient and organized discussions. Microsoft Teams and Zoom go a step further by offering video conferencing features, which enable face-to-face communication and help maintain a sense of connection among team members.

In order to ensure remote work success, project management tools like Trello or Asana are essential. These tools help employees stay organized, set priorities, and track the progress of their tasks, ensuring that projects are completed within the assigned timelines. They also provide a transparent view of the overall project status, enabling teams to collaborate effectively and work towards a common goal.

Overall, by utilizing essential technologies like communication and collaboration tools such as Slack, Microsoft Teams, and Zoom, as well as project management tools like Trello or Asana, remote teams can overcome the challenges of distance and achieve success. These technologies offer the necessary infrastructure to foster teamwork, maintain productivity, and streamline workflows, enabling remote work to be as efficient and effective as in-person work environments.

Communication barriers

Communication barriers can be a major hindrance to remote team collaboration, as they can create misunderstandings, decrease productivity, and impede the overall success of the team. One significant barrier is the lack of non-verbal cues, such as body language and facial expressions, which are essential for effective communication. Without these visual cues, understanding the intentions and emotions of team members can be challenging.

Another barrier is the physical distance between team members, which can result in delays and difficulties in communicating in real-time. Time zone differences and limited availability can further exacerbate these challenges. Additionally, technological issues, such as poor internet connectivity or communication tools that are not user-friendly, can impede effective communication.

To overcome these barriers and facilitate remote team collaboration, it is essential to promote clear and concise communication. Encouraging team members to use written communication effectively, such as making use of organized and structured documentation, can help reduce misunderstandings. Utilizing video calls and virtual meetings can also bridge the gap caused by the lack of non-verbal cues, enabling more interactive and engaging communication.

Establishing regular communication schedules and ensuring adequate availability can help address the challenges posed by physical distance and time zone differences. Providing training and support regarding the use of communication tools can also enhance remote communication. Additionally, fostering a culture of open communication and active listening can promote understanding and collaboration among team members.

Overall, by recognizing the communication barriers in remote team collaboration and implementing strategies to overcome them, teams can enhance their communication effectiveness and achieve better collaboration.

Lack of in-person collaboration

The lack of in-person collaboration in virtual offices poses several challenges and drawbacks that can hinder effective teamwork and communication. Without face-to-face interaction and physical presence, it becomes difficult for team members to establish and build personal connections, which are crucial for fostering trust and open communication. Non-verbal cues also play a significant role in communication, and the absence of these cues can lead to misinterpretation of messages and ideas.

Team dynamics are heavily impacted by the lack of in-person collaboration. The informal interactions that occur in traditional offices, such as casual conversations or lunch breaks, often contribute to team bonding and cohesion. In a virtual office, these opportunities are limited, making it harder to develop a sense of camaraderie. Consequently, team members may feel isolated and disconnected from one another, which can negatively affect morale and collaboration.

Creativity can suffer without in-person collaboration. Brainstorming sessions and collaborative problem-solving are often more effective when done in person, as the energy and enthusiasm of team members can be contagious. Additionally, the physical environment of a traditional office, such as whiteboards or sticky notes, can play a role in stimulating creative thinking. In a virtual office, replicating this environment can be challenging.

Productivity can also be affected by the lack of in-person collaboration. Quick and spontaneous discussions to resolve issues or make decisions become more time-consuming in a virtual setting. Without immediate access to colleagues, delays can occur, and projects may be slowed down.

To overcome these challenges, it is essential to implement strategies and solutions that foster effective collaboration and communication in virtual offices. Regular video conferences or virtual meetings can help create a sense of connection and allow for face-to-face interactions. Implementing virtual team-building activities and social events can also help to strengthen team dynamics. Utilizing digital collaboration tools, such as shared documents or online whiteboards, can facilitate brainstorming sessions and creative collaboration. Establishing clear communication channels and expectations can help mitigate misunderstandings and ensure timely responses.

Overall, while the lack of in-person collaboration in virtual offices presents challenges, with the right strategies and solutions, effective teamwork, communication, and productivity can still be achieved.

Difficulty in maintaining company culture

Maintaining a strong company culture can be challenging in the face of remote work, a diverse workforce, and rapid growth. Remote work presents the obstacle of physical separation, making it difficult to foster a sense of belonging and shared values among employees. Strategies such as regular video meetings, virtual team-building activities, and clear communication channels can help bridge the gap and maintain a sense of unity.

A diverse workforce brings the challenge of different backgrounds, perspectives, and expectations. To maintain a cohesive culture, organizations must cultivate an inclusive environment where everyone feels valued and heard. Encouraging diversity and inclusion training, creating affinity groups, and promoting open dialogue are effective strategies to ensure that employees from various backgrounds feel supported and included.

Rapid growth can also disrupt company culture as new employees are onboarded and different teams are formed. To manage this, organizations can prioritize integrating new hires into company values, providing a comprehensive onboarding process, and fostering communication and collaboration across teams.

Changes in the work environment, such as the shift to remote work or the introduction of flexible schedules, can impact company culture. Organizations must be agile and adapt their culture to align with these changes. Maintaining transparent and open communication, providing opportunities for feedback, and acknowledging and addressing employees' evolving expectations are essential strategies to navigate these shifts while preserving the company's core values.

Overall, maintaining company culture amidst remote work, a diverse workforce, rapid growth, and changes in the work environment requires proactive strategies that foster inclusion, communication, and adaptability.
